Donimo · 23/11/2025 21:13

For the plane take something to suck at take off to help with their ears- a dummy or cup with bottle top or something. Take plenty of easy to eat snacks. Make sure you have changes of clothes to include a spare t shirt for yourself. I would take baby carrier/sling to carry them off the plane as often the pushchair won't be delivered back to the plane and have to collect at baggage reclaim. I found mine sleep well on the plane so depending on flight times try to time it with naps.

I also order some baby food pouches, baby snacks and calpol to collect in boots in departures. You can do a boots click and collect from the airport departures. So then you have it for the plane but then some backup food options whilst there.

What inflatable were you thinking of? I'd just take whatever it is you use to go swimming at home. As some children/babies don't like/get on with certain ones. Is the pool heated? You might want to look at a wet suit style swim suit in Jan. We went to Lanzorote in Jan and Turkey in Oct with babies and the water was just too cold for them.

I agree buy nappies out there. With swim nappies I use reusable ones so just take 1 with me and wash it out.
